通过pip安装docx库,这里安装的是0.2.4版本
默认已经安装了,相关依赖,但是在使用的时候还是报错如下:
“from exceptions import PendingDeprecationWarning ModuleNotFoundError: No module named ‘exception”
其他说法:
问题
import docx时,
由from exceptions import PendingDeprecationWarning
引起ModuleNotFoundError: No module named ‘exceptions’
解决方式
由于Python3已经取消了这个模块,而 PendingDeprecationWarning 是内置,所以可以直接使用。故注释掉from exceptions import PendingDeprecationWarning
还有说要先卸载docx,我这里测试不用卸载
最终解决方案如下:
查了各种资料,很多种说法,下面是解决方法,需要单独在安装【python-docx】【 0.8.11】,我这里是默认安装的,就安装了这个版本
pip install python-docx